Media query para tablet
A media query para tablet é uma técnica essencial no desenvolvimento de sites responsivos, permitindo que os desenvolvedores ajustem o design e a funcionalidade de uma página da web com base nas características do dispositivo em que está sendo visualizada. Essa abordagem é fundamental para garantir uma experiência de usuário otimizada em dispositivos de diferentes tamanhos, especialmente em tablets, que possuem uma resolução intermediária entre smartphones e desktops.
As media queries utilizam regras CSS que se aplicam somente quando determinadas condições são atendidas, como a largura da tela. Por exemplo, uma media query pode ser configurada para aplicar estilos específicos quando a largura da tela estiver entre 600px e 900px, que é a faixa típica para tablets. Isso permite que os designers criem layouts que se adaptam perfeitamente a essas dimensões, melhorando a legibilidade e a usabilidade.
Um exemplo prático de uma media query para tablet em CSS é o seguinte:
@media only screen and (min-width: 600px) and (max-width: 900px) {
body {
font-size: 16px;
}
.container {
width: 80%;
margin: 0 auto;
}
}
Neste exemplo, quando a largura da tela do dispositivo estiver entre 600px e 900px, o tamanho da fonte do corpo será ajustado para 16px e a largura do contêiner será definida como 80% da tela, centralizando-o. Essa flexibilidade é crucial para a criação de um design responsivo que se adapta às necessidades dos usuários.
Além disso, as media queries podem ser combinadas com outras técnicas de design responsivo, como o uso de unidades relativas (como % e em) e imagens responsivas, para garantir que todos os elementos da página se ajustem de maneira harmoniosa em diferentes dispositivos. Isso é especialmente importante para o conteúdo visual, que deve ser otimizado para não comprometer a velocidade de carregamento e a experiência do usuário.
Outra consideração importante ao implementar media queries para tablet é a performance. O uso excessivo de media queries pode levar a um aumento no tempo de carregamento da página, especialmente se muitas regras CSS forem aplicadas. Portanto, é recomendável agrupar as media queries de forma lógica e evitar a duplicação de estilos sempre que possível.
Ferramentas como o Chrome DevTools podem ser extremamente úteis para testar e visualizar como as media queries afetam o layout em diferentes tamanhos de tela. Com essas ferramentas, os desenvolvedores podem simular diferentes dispositivos e ajustar suas media queries em tempo real, garantindo que o design seja responsivo e funcional.
Além disso, é importante considerar o uso de frameworks CSS, como o Bootstrap ou o Foundation, que já vêm com um sistema de grid responsivo e media queries pré-definidas. Esses frameworks podem acelerar o processo de desenvolvimento e garantir que o site seja compatível com uma ampla gama de dispositivos, incluindo tablets.
Por fim, a implementação de media queries para tablet não é apenas uma questão estética, mas também uma estratégia de SEO. Um site que oferece uma experiência de usuário superior em dispositivos móveis tende a ter uma melhor classificação nos resultados de busca do Google, uma vez que o algoritmo do Google prioriza sites responsivos que atendem às necessidades dos usuários.